One more thing I would like to say (so as to ease Rena’s anxieties, I hope). I honestly don’t think David should be compared to other runner-ups, especially since the track record shows that they are not usually successful.
Season 1 runner-up: Justin Guarini. He was never taken seriously as an Idol contestant talent-wise, let alone as a music artist. David does not have that problem since even his haters acknowledge his talent.
Season 2 runner-up: Clay Aiken. He has been the most successful runner-up to date, but that’s due to the rabid fanbase that was the Claymates, and they had something to prove (that he really did win his year since many wanted to dispute the votes). However, I think a key difference between Claymates and ArchAngels is that we are no longer invested in the show and in proving that David was the rightful winner (not when the show insists he lost by 12 million votes). And, although some Archies are still invested in the competition, it does seem that the majority have moved on, and, better yet, David has impacted on non-Idol watchers since “Crush” has done tremendously well beyond the Idol bubble and beyond his Original Archies fanbase.
Season 3 runner-up: Diana DeGarmo. There was a concerted effort to not support Diana, precisely because, the year before, the runner-up had outsold the winner. It was very clear that 19 heavily promoted Fantasia while downplaying Diana, hence why the runner-up flopped (not to mention her album was mediocre). Just from the snippets we’ve heard, I think we can safely predict that David’s album won’t be viewed as mediocre. As long as the music is good, it will sell and it will impact.
Season 4 and 5 runner-ups: Bo Bice and Katherine McPhee had a lot of potential, but they had tremendous conflict with their labels, not to mention their albums just weren’t very good. Again, David won’t have this problem, and whatever conflicts he may have had, I think David is more than capable of compromising. Plus, he’s young enough to learn and grow.
Season 6 runner-up: Blake Lewis – sold pretty decently for a new artist, IMO, but his label Arista was not impressed, and his “diva” attitude so early on in his career led to a lot of bridges being burned down very quickly. David clearly does not have an attitude problem to be burning any bridges.
All this is to say: I think David is positioned very well to be extremely successful. He’s got the talent, he’s got the looks, the youth, the energy, he’s got the right attitude, and he’s signed to a label and management that, so far, are not using his Idol beginnings as some sort of crutch to promote him.
I think he’ll be fine. And he’s with a label that has the experience and savvy to market and help “grow” their young talents into serious artists by the time they reach adulthood. I do believe Jive sees David as a long-term investment and not some quick buck to cash in on while he’s in the public limelight.

momofteens #300, I remember reading reviews for Britney’s previous outing, “Blackout.” I remember critics’ praise being pretty exclusively focused on what the producers had done in creating catchy dance tracks and creating material that was suited to the limits of Britney’s voice. I listened to the album and I actually really liked it for the same reasons.
The critics’ approach fascinated me, because, at least for some genres of music like pop and dance music, they evaluated artists’ albums primarily in terms of their viability as commercial products. They focused on aspects of the music related to its commercial viability and only secondarily focused on aspects of musical artistry. (It reminds me of how TV “political commentators” talk about campaign tactics so much as if we were discussing a sport and who has the “best election strategy,” as opposed to the debating the underlying substantive issues themselves.)
It is likely that David’s debut will get some of that approach. I personally expect that a lot of critics will praise David’s voice and direct much of their criticism at the production and arrangement of the album, and whether certain songs have commercial potential.
